Use a Wedge and Long-Reach Tool
There are a variety of reasons why vehicles lock themselves out. Some are human errors and others are technical. It is important to do everything you can to prevent such instances. There are some things you can do to avoid being locked out of your car.
Another alternative is to use a wedge to create a gap between the door frame and the body of the vehicle. Then, you can move the rod, or straight wire clotheshanger through the gap, to trigger the door handle's inner. This method can be difficult to use in a small space.
Another option is to purchase a device with a long reach designed for car lockouts. Most of these tools come with a sleeve that can be used to prevent damage to the weather stripping, paint and the edge of the car door during a lockout. The sleeve also protects your fingers and hand when using the long-reach tool.
These tools are bent into regular configurations to be utilized immediately in all situations. Some tools come with in a different color to aid in their identification in dim light. For maximum versatility, you can try the Ultimate Long Reach Tool Kit that includes four of the most well-known long-reach tools. It also includes a Button Master and Mega Master snare tool with two air wedges, a protective lockout tape, a slim jim, windshield-mounted flashlights for nighttime openings and more.

Call for Help
It's not only frustrating but also risky to be locked out of your vehicle. If you attempt to unlock your car without the right tools could lead to damage that makes it harder to gain access to your vehicle in the future. Professional lockout services are equipped with the necessary tools and know-how to unlock your car quickly and without causing damage. This will cut down on time and ease the stress.
If you're stuck with your keys locked in your car, remain calm and seek help. Do not attempt to unlock your car using the DIY techniques you've seen on the Internet. These methods may work for certain vehicles but they can cause serious damage to modern vehicles that have advanced locking mechanisms.
Your local towing company can provide a lockout service at affordable costs. Certain automakers also provide smartphone apps to unlock cars remotely. If you own a car from one of these manufacturers and have an active warranty or roadside assistance program, be sure to review their app offerings for more details on how to utilize them.
Another option is to call your car dealer to inquire if they can help you unlock your vehicle. This service can be provided at no cost or at a low cost, depending on the manufacturer and the relationship you have with the dealership. Certain non-profit organizations and community support organizations offer assistance to those who are locked out of their car. To learn more about the options available in your area you can contact your local community centers or social service organizations.
